I won't get super in depth, so I'll just sum it up. It makes perfect sense, but people definitely don't think about it. Basically, it's about how we view other people. We observe people acting a certain way, and assume that their behavior is indicative of their personality or normal disposition. We tend to completely disregard the situation at hand. We don't think about how the situation affects how people behave.

I've been thinking about this all SO much lately for a lot of reasons. First of all, because I realize that I've harshly judged people and made assumptions about them based on how they act in certain situations, without realizing that the situation could be COMPLETELY driving their behavior, and their behavior in that situation might not be ANY indicator of how they really are!

And also, because I myself have been judged (in some cases, rightfully so) by my behavior in certain situations and I KNOW that that's not really what I'm all about.
